Effects of Ultraviolet Blood Irradiation in a Type 1 Diabetic Rabbit

Abstract
The purpose of this study is to evaluate the effects of ultraviolet blood irradiation on the blood when a low dose of ultraviolet (UV) C is directly irradiated to the blood in a diabetic rabbit model and to evaluate the effects on treatment for diabetes. This study results indicate that the reduced body weight is increased and blood glucose levels are significantly reduced after the UBI treatment is performed when compared to those prior to the UBI treatment. In addition, $HCO_3{^-}$ levels and blood pH were elevated and lowered, respectively. When the UBI treatment is performed in a diabetic rabbit model, in this result indicate that blood glucose levels are reduced.
